Comparing Fiji with North Peoria, Illinois

Compare Climate information for Fiji and North Peoria, Illinois

Is Fiji warmer or hotter than North Peoria, Illinois?

On average across the year, yes, Fiji is hotter than North Peoria, Illinois . Fiji has an average temperature of 26°C/79°F and North Peoria, Illinois has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.

Fiji's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than North Peoria, Illinois's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).

Is Fiji colder or cooler than North Peoria, Illinois?

On average across the year, no, Fiji is not colder than North Peoria, Illinois . Fiji has an average minimum temperature of 23°C/73°F and North Peoria, Illinois has an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F.



Fiji's coldest month is July, with an average minimum temperature of 21°C/70°F, which is not colder than North Peoria, Illinois's coldest month (January, with an average minimum temperature of -8°C/18°F).

Does Fiji have more rain than North Peoria, Illinois?

On average across the year, yes, Fiji has more rain than North Peoria, Illinois. Fiji has an average annual rainfall of 1611mm and North Peoria, Illinois has an average annual rainfall of 1149mm.

Fiji's wettest month is March, with an average monthly rainfall of 222mm, which is wetter than North Peoria, Illinois's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 141mm).
